Riyadh – Mubasher: Batic Investments and Logistics Co’s board of directors decided to raise the company’s capital by 25% through distributing bonus shares in ratio 1:4. 

The company’s capital will grow to SAR 300 million, up from SAR 240 million, hence, shares will increase to 30 million shares from 24 million, Batic said in a filing to the Saudi Stock Market (Tadawul) on Tuesday.

The proposed increase in capital aims at achieving a balance between the company’s capital and assets, as well as bolstering its future investment plans, the company indicated.

The Tadawul-listed company will boost its capital through capitalising SAR 60 million from retained earnings, the company noted.

The eligibility will be for shareholders registered at the ordinary general meeting (OGM) date, which will be set subsequently, as well as shareholders registered the day after eligibility.

Batic’s stock closed Monday’s trading session up 1.62% to SAR 62.91.
